Question about aligning T56 to motor
I recently bought the QuickTime scattershield. Upon reading about the alignment procedure, I now understand some of the issues I have had. Since the motor was rebuilt the trans had had issues twice, and it hasn't shifted well at high rpm. I suspect the alignment is off.
Unfortunately it seems measuring the T56 cars isn't easy.
My question is, do I have to use the front plate from my transmission, or can it be from any T56? I just got my trans back from being rebuilt and don't like the idea of taking it apart.
I went ahead and ordered all three offset pin kits. I think I understand what needs to be done, and want to do it right, but am hung at this point.
